Family tree Weening » Hendrikus Willebrordus Kaak (1893-1968)

Personal data Hendrikus Willebrordus Kaak 


Household of Hendrikus Willebrordus Kaak

He is married to Johanna Catharina Josephina Weenink.

They got married on June 15, 1931 at Lichtenvoorde (Gd), he was 37 years old.Source 1
